Heads or Stealth ram?

Ok, I currently picked up a 355 shortblock for my formula. Now my question is, Should I spend the money on a set of heads, or on the holley stealth ram to replace that tpi? Either way I will have to pick up heads, the heads that are currently on the old engine are crappy 305's, and I dont want those.

So basically my question is, Spend the 600-700 on a nice set of heads and keep the TPI? Or spend the money on the stealth ram and pick up a set of 083 heads to use with it?

Keep in mind money is kinda tight so I cant do heads and intake at the same time. I know the TPI is mostly what restricts the power. How good are the 083 heads stock? I know they are 64cc which is what i want to keep the CR in the 9 range.

Get some aluminum heads first.
I put a HSR on my nearly stock engine with stock heads. The intake port on the stock head is smaller then the stealth ram. .. might create some turbulance.

That being said...
At the track;
Stock heads, cam, intake.
I ran 89mph

Stock heads, cam, and a HSR
89mph.

Buy some heads first.
This was with my L98.
